Re: Cheap emulator alternatives
For price all you would need to do is flatten the sealing surfaces on the emulator on a bit of glass with fine emery.
They aren't shims like in a cartridge so I don't think the quality of those would matter much, shims in cartridge are made of a specific spring steel because they need to flex so well and consistently, these emulators just use checkplates.
Spacers are easy to find/remake and IMO the damper rod mods are easy to undo.
